To check whether microfiber leather for car samples match mass production, compare the approved sample and production rolls under the same color, grain, thickness, width, surface appearance, abrasion, tensile, peeling, scratch, and flame-retardant criteria. Confirm color consistency through matching records, review production and laboratory results, and retain pre-shipment samples for traceability before accepting the batch.
Sample-to-production verification should use a controlled comparison process. Keep the approved microfiber leather for car sample beside production material and assess the same areas in the same order: color, grain clarity, thickness, width, surface appearance, softness, and leather-like appearance.
The product is microfiber synthetic leather designed for sofas and automotive upholstery. Its specified thickness is 0.8–1.4 mm, with a width of 54/55 inches. The material is described as having high abrasion resistance, high tensile and tearing strength, hydrolysis resistance, durability, and easy-clean performance.
Color and grain should be checked against the approved reference under consistent inspection conditions. Compare the production roll with the confirmed color-matching record and verify that customized color and grain requirements are maintained across the batch. Visible differences in shade, grain depth, backing, or surface finish should be recorded before shipment.
Dimensional checks cover thickness and width. Compare measured production values with the approved sample and the customer’s specification. Surface inspection should identify changes in appearance, defects, uneven coating, or inconsistent texture. Hand feel and natural leather appearance should remain consistent with the approved material.
Performance verification requires laboratory and production inspection. The product quality plan includes abrasion resistance, tensile strength, peeling strength, scratch resistance, and flame-retardant performance according to customer requirements. Hydrolysis resistance and easy-clean performance should also be reviewed when they are part of the order specification.
A documented release decision should combine the inspection results, approved sample, production process records, laboratory data, finished-product inspection, and pre-shipment inspection. | Inspection Area | Sample-to-Production Check | Acceptance Evidence |
|---|---|---|
| Appearance and dimensions | Compare color, grain, thickness, width, surface appearance, hand feel, and leather-like appearance | Approved sample, color-matching confirmation, and dimensional inspection records |
| Physical performance | Check abrasion, tensile, tearing, peeling, scratch, hydrolysis, and durability requirements | Laboratory test results and production inspection records |
| Functional performance | Verify flame-retardant, UV-resistant, waterproof, stain-resistant, and easy-clean properties when specified | Customer-required test results and finished-product inspection |
| Production consistency | Review raw material, process, finished-product, and pre-shipment inspections | Complete quality inspection documentation before shipment |
| Order control | Confirm the approved sample, production progress, and shipment status | Sample approval, progress updates, shipment tracking, and quality support |
What characteristics should be compared between a car microfiber leather sample and mass production?
Compare color, grain, thickness, width, surface appearance, hand feel, natural leather appearance, abrasion resistance, tensile and tearing strength, peeling strength, scratch resistance, hydrolysis resistance, easy-clean performance, and any specified flame-retardant or UV-resistant requirements.
How can color consistency be verified across production rolls?
Use the approved sample and color-matching confirmation as references. Inspect production rolls for shade, grain, and surface consistency, then review the production inspection and laboratory records before approving the shipment.
What should be done if mass production does not match the approved sample?
Record the difference, identify whether it concerns color, grain, dimensions, appearance, or performance, and request technical verification. For confirmed product quality issues, replacement, replenishment, compensation, or a technical solution may be provided according to the actual situation.
